On Tue, Jan 07, 2020 at 06:47:34PM +0100, Wolfram Sang wrote:
> This patch series converts the I2C subsystem to use the new API. Drivers
> have been build tested. There is one user left in the SMBus part of the
> core which will need a seperate series because all users of this
> function need to be checked/converted, too.
> 
> Except for documentation patches, the conversion has been done with a
> coccinelle script and further simplification have been applied when
> proofreading the patches.
> 
> A branch is here:
> 
> git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/wsa/linux.git renesas/i2c/new_client_device
> 
> Looking forward to comments...

Thanks for all the quick reviews and tests \o/

Series applied to for-next, thanks!
